Nexus One by HTC and Google

Nexus One, or Nek-thith one is coming to the market in 5 Jan 2010. The operating system is Android from Google, with 512mb RAM and ROM. It comes with a ball, like the one in the blackberries and Touch (a7) screen. In addition, 5MP Camera and 4gb memory card. I won’t say will come with WiFi and 3G .. etc, because a mobile without these things worth nothing.

The price is: 530US .. kinda expensive for a cheap mobile.

Review 0.5: Macbook Pro

Using Mac for the first time is hard, only for the first week. In fact, it is a great machine to graphics and making some videos. Yes, there is many programs that help you to use Mac. What I love in Mac, the way how they design this laptop, how they program an operating system to fit with anyone. I used ubtuntu, you can say they are the same, but you can’t enjoy the high resolution from the monitor. They care about all tiny details that do not let feel sorry to buy this laptop.

After 10 years of using PC, I have to say it: I love you both, MAC and PC. Its hard to leave PC because Mac still do not support Arabic language like PC. I’m using MAC for graphics and videos editing, and PC to for .. everything else.
